The Unseen Engine: Data Supporting the Digital Art Revolution

The computer graphics industry is a colossal and continuously expanding sector. According to various market research reports, the global computer graphics market, valued at approximately $21.3 billion in 2023, is projected to reach over $50 billion by 2032, exhibiting a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of around 10.5%. This growth is fueled by increasing demand across diverse applications, including film and television visual effects, video games, architectural visualization, product design, virtual reality (VR), augmented reality (AR), and even medical imaging.

Within this rapidly expanding market, hundreds of new software features, plugins, hardware components, and artistic techniques emerge annually. Major industry players like Autodesk, Adobe, Epic Games, Maxon, and Chaos Group regularly release updates and entirely new products, each requiring careful analysis and understanding by professionals. The sheer volume of this technical information, coupled with the intricate nature of CG workflows, makes specialized news platforms indispensable. It is estimated that millions of artists, designers, and developers globally utilize CG tools daily, forming a vast and interconnected professional community. For these individuals, staying current is not merely an academic exercise but a professional imperative that directly impacts their productivity, competitiveness, and career trajectory.
